Directions for use
Start with a primer to even out the texture of your skin. Using a beauty blender, brush or fingers, apply strategically to even out skin tone and illuminate. If you have oily skin, you can use powder all over. If you're dryer on the cheeks and around your nose, powder your forehead and chin. Once you've set your look, breath some tone and life back into your skin with bronzer or blush.
